Pirelli isn't producing tires in 15 inches it's why it is not Pirelli tires on Milavec's car and also why the Superleague Formula weren't in Hockenheim.
Peter Milavec used Hoosier tires in Hockenheim.

The 2017 season of the Boss GP championship is now finished.

It was a disapointing season for Boss enthusiasts with small grids and a lack of competition in Open Class.

With no surprise, Ingo Gerstl is the 2017 champion in Open Class while Mahaveer Raghunathan won in Formula Class.

It's hard to say. For sure, the switch to the Pirelli banned the 15 inches cars (ChampCar, IndyCar and Superleague) as Pirelli isn't producing tyres in that dimension. It's sad, because those cars were good for the championship.

Also some drivers moved to other series, like LMP3 and LMP2.

2016 was great, it's disapointing that the grids dropped off in 2017.

There are plenty of problems:


1. Pirelli pneus. They don't fit to a lot of cars like the Superleague Formula cars or IndyCars. So that's why we see only GP2 cars and some (but less) F1 cars.



2. They have a new structure with longtime coordinator Christian Gaense left Boss GP before the new season starts. I think they were some disagreements with Ingo Gerstl, the real boss of Boss GP.


3. There are a lot of diagreements between drivers. Some drivers like Gerstl wants more professional drivers and some like Karl-Heinz Becker more amateur level drivers.


So for me it looks like Boss GP hasn't a real good future.

What is a series about which ran 10 GP2 cars, 1-2 dominant F1 cars and that was it?
